TL;DR
A new, first-of-its-kind hot dog bun is launching soon, aiming to improve hot dog consumption. Its unique design has generated significant interest among consumers and food innovators.
A new, innovative hot dog bun designed to enhance the hot dog-eating experience is set to be released soon, according to sources close to the development. This product aims to address common issues like bun splitting and messy eating, promising a more convenient and enjoyable snack. Its arrival is considered a significant innovation in the food packaging and fast-food sectors, with potential implications for consumers and vendors alike.
The product, described as a first-of-its-kind hot dog bun, features a unique design that purportedly improves grip and reduces bun splitting during consumption. Early reports suggest it incorporates a special material or structural innovation, although specific technical details have not yet been publicly disclosed. The bun is expected to be available in select markets within the next few weeks, with official release details pending.
According to Allrecipes, the concept has garnered over 2,000 searches, indicating strong consumer interest. Food industry insiders have confirmed that the product is in the final stages of testing and manufacturing, but no official launch date has been announced by the manufacturer. The company behind the bun has declined to specify the exact features or the technology involved, citing competitive reasons.

Background on Hot Dog Bun Innovations and Market Trends
Traditional hot dog buns have remained largely unchanged for decades, often leading to issues like bun splitting and difficulty holding toppings. Recent years have seen some attempts at innovation, such as pre-sliced or flavored buns, but none have addressed structural problems comprehensively. The current development signals a new focus on functional design aimed at improving consumer experience.
Interest in such innovations has grown, partly driven by increased demand for convenience foods and the rise of social media sharing of food experiences. The concept of a specialized hot dog bun has been discussed in online forums and food innovation circles, but this marks the first confirmed launch of a product explicitly marketed as a first-of-its-kind solution.
